DMBLGIT October 2011

So many wonderful photos have been submitted over the course of this month for the DMBLGIT October 2011 event. There were a wide range of photos that each showed dedication and talent for the culinary world. Each day during this month Sydney and I would look in my inbox for new email submissions that seemed to jump out of the screen and greet us with inspiring and delicious looking food and photographs.

We received a total of 36 photos from many different blogs, that each told a unique story about the individuals participating in this challenge. You can still check these photos out in the gallery. Now…here is the moment everyone has been waiting for…the winners for this month are:

Overall 1st Place: 

These include the highest scoring photos:

Homemade Ice Cream

  Pamela of Uno De Dos  (Canon EOS 350D- 25mm- 4.5- 1/100- 200)

Some Comments from the Judges include:

Bron:  “Fun, love the bite out”

Shannon: “I love this photo! What a unique and great way to display and photograph Ice Cream. The colors, contrast, and composition in this photo are great”

Jeanne: “Simply gorgeous-excellent props, composition and exposure”

Sydney: “This photos is stunning, fun, and creative”

Overall 2nd Place: 

Gâteau au Fromage Blanc 0%MG (in english: 0% fat cheesecake)

    Steeve of Cuisine Airlines (taken with Nikon D90 with 50mm f1.8 lens)

Comments from the Judges:

Bron: “Lovely”

Shannon: “The color contrast in this photo is beautiful”

Jeanne: “Lovely pale palette really makes the most of the berries, great use of shallow DoF”

Sydney: “When my mom and I first saw this photo were delighted to see fromage blanc was used, and the currents add an amazing extra to the cheesecake photo”

Overall 3rd Place:

Tart with Caramelized Figs and Almonds

  Ago of Pane, Burro e Marmellata (taken with Nikon D3000 – 50 mm)

Comments from the Judges:

Shannon: ” I love this photo. It looks and sounds delicious”

Jeanne: “Lovely shot, painterly lighting, visible and appealing textures”

Sydney: “I absolutely love this photo. I love figs and almonds, this photo just screams delicious, I want to grab it from the computer screen!”
